Xe Money Transfer vs Ria Money Transfer

Two money-transfer brands can both be reputable and still suit completely different customers. This comparison checks the practical decision points: the final recipient amount, delivery method, speed, transfer size, support, account features and currency-risk tools.

Provider facts checked 25 July 2026. Live prices and availability can change by route.

The short verdict

Xe Money Transfer has the broader fit across our current comparison criteria, but that is not a reason to choose it blindly. Xe Money Transfer is the more natural fit for bank-to-bank international transfers, recurring needs and users familiar with xe currency tools. Ria Money Transfer is stronger for recipients who need cash collection and senders who value online plus physical-agent options.

For a real transfer, request both quotes within the same few minutes and compare the exact amount arriving. That one number captures the transfer fee and exchange-rate margin together.

Xe Money Transfer and Ria Money Transfer compared

These are service characteristics, not a live price promise. Routes, eligibility and verification can change the available options.

Decision pointXe Money TransferRia Money Transfer
Best suited toBank-to-bank international transfers, recurring needs and users familiar with Xe currency toolsRecipients who need cash collection and senders who value online plus physical-agent options
Pricing structureA transfer fee may apply depending on route and amount, while the exchange-rate margin also affects the result.The upfront fee varies by payment method, delivery method, destination and amount; the exchange rate also affects total cost.
Exchange rateXe provides a customer exchange rate that differs from the informational mid-market rate shown by its converter.Ria sets a route-specific customer exchange rate shown with the fee before payment.
MinimumRoute dependentRoute dependent
ReachBroad international bank-transfer reach across more than 100 currencies and 200 countries and territories, subject to sender eligibility.190+ countries and more than 600,000 cash-pickup locations, alongside bank and wallet routes where supported.
Typical deliveryCommon transfers can complete within one to three working days after funding and checks.Some cash and digital routes can complete in minutes; bank delivery and compliance checks may take longer.
FundingBank transfer and selected card methods, depending on countryBank transfer, card, app or in-person cash depending on sender market
Recipient optionsPrimarily recipient bank accountCash pickup, bank deposit and mobile wallet depending on destination
Personal customersYesYes
Business customersYesNot the core UK comparison use case
Account featuresWeb and app transfer accountTransfer app and web account, not a multi-currency current account
Currency-risk toolsBusiness risk-management and forward tools may be available through eligible regional servicesNo forward contracts
Customer supportOnline and telephone serviceOnline support and physical agent network

Fees and exchange rates: compare the amount that arrives

Xe Money Transfer pricing

A transfer fee may apply depending on route and amount, while the exchange-rate margin also affects the result.

Rate method: Xe provides a customer exchange rate that differs from the informational mid-market rate shown by its converter.

Ria Money Transfer pricing

The upfront fee varies by payment method, delivery method, destination and amount; the exchange rate also affects total cost.

Rate method: Ria sets a route-specific customer exchange rate shown with the fee before payment.

Match the transfer

Use the same send amount, currency pair, funding method and recipient method.

Quote at the same time

Foreign-exchange markets move. Old screenshots and introductory offers are not like-for-like evidence.

Compare what arrives

Use the recipient amount after all provider fees. Ask whether intermediary-bank deductions remain possible.

Money Transfer Comparison does not rank a provider as cheapest from a transfer-fee label alone. A wider exchange-rate margin can outweigh a zero-fee claim.

Where each provider is strong, and where it is not

Xe Money Transfer

An international transfer service from the well-known Xe currency brand, serving personal and business bank-account transfers.

Reasons to shortlist it

  • Broad currency and destination coverage
  • Recognised currency-data brand
  • Personal and business transfer services

Reasons to look elsewhere

  • Converter rate is not necessarily the send rate
  • Limited alternative payout methods
  • Exact pricing needs a route-specific quote

Usually not the right fit for: Cash pickup in most markets, everyday multi-currency spending and customers requiring one published universal margin

Ria Money Transfer

A large remittance network supporting app, web and agent transfers with extensive cash-pickup coverage.

Reasons to shortlist it

  • Very large physical cash-pickup network
  • Online, app and in-person sending choices
  • Multiple recipient delivery methods

Reasons to look elsewhere

  • Total pricing changes by route and funding method
  • Not designed for hedging or high-value FX planning
  • Country-specific limits can be restrictive

Usually not the right fit for: Currency hedging, specialist property transfers and multi-currency accounts

Safety, regulation and customer-money protection

“Regulated” is not a complete answer. Confirm the exact company named in your terms, find it on the relevant regulator’s register, and distinguish safeguarding from bank-deposit insurance.

Xe Money Transfer

Regulated regional entities handle transfers. Check the contracting entity and safeguarding disclosure for the sender country.

Ria Money Transfer

Regulated entities vary by sender country. Funds in transit are handled under payment-services rules, not as an FSCS savings deposit.

For a high-value transfer, send a small test payment where practical, verify recipient details independently, enable two-factor authentication and never accept an unexpected request to change bank details without a second-channel check.

Choose by transfer type, not brand recognition

Define the non-negotiable

Is this a property deadline, a family cash pickup, a business batch run or money you need to hold and spend?

Confirm eligibility

Check sender residence, destination, currency, transfer size, funding source and recipient method before comparing price.

Document the quote

Record the time, fee, rate, recipient amount and promised delivery. For large transfers, ask when the rate expires.

Frequently asked questions

Which is better, Xe Money Transfer or Ria Money Transfer?

There is no universal winner. Xe Money Transfer is strongest for bank-to-bank international transfers, recurring needs and users familiar with xe currency tools, while Ria Money Transfer is strongest for recipients who need cash collection and senders who value online plus physical-agent options. Compare live recipient amounts for your route before deciding.

Which is better for a large international transfer?

Xe Money Transfer has the stronger fit in this comparison for a large or complex bank-to-bank transfer. For property or business payments, obtain at least two live quotes and confirm documentation before fixing a rate.

Which is better for small transfers or remittances?

Ria Money Transfer has the stronger small-transfer and remittance fit in the current methodology. The real result still depends on the corridor, funding method and recipient payout option.

Which is better for business payments?

Xe Money Transfer scores more strongly for business use in this comparison. Check account eligibility, batch-payment needs, local receiving details and any forward-contract requirements.

Which is faster?

Ria Money Transfer has the stronger general speed profile, but neither provider can guarantee every transfer time. Funding cut-offs, banking hours, destination networks and compliance reviews all matter.

How should I compare the exchange rates?

Enter the same send amount, currency pair, payment method and delivery method with both providers at nearly the same time. Compare the exact amount the recipient receives after every fee. An advertised zero fee does not mean zero exchange-rate cost.

Are these companies banks?

Do not assume so. Payment institutions, electronic money institutions and banks have different customer-money protections. Read the named regulatory entity and safeguarding or deposit-protection disclosure before funding the transfer.
